COLONIAL SAFARI
DURATION: ONE DAY / ALL THE YEAR

When the Spanish people colonized Peru, the kings shared the land and theirs inhabitants out as a reward for the Conquistadors’deeds.
Zana Valley was chosen by the settlers because of its location, for is fertile land and abundant water. Zana is full of history, customs, food, dance and religion which demonstrate the mixing up between African and Lambayeque culture.
The city of Lambayeque is another expression of the importance of the region at the time of the colony, which hides among its major buildings the balcony of the Colonial South America.

HIGHLIGHTS: Churches and great colonial buildings, Afro-peruvian museum.
